Our reading

Neostar 2P+48 Dual-Glass scores 70, placing 14 of 53 in the Premium Performance class against a class average of 69.0. Its strongest scoring dimension is architecture & design (94), running 7.5 points above the class average on this dimension. Guarantee & Backbone scores 42, the lowest pillar for this product. The class average on guarantee & backbone is 54. Underlying specifications include a module efficiency of 24.8%, N-type ABC cell technology, 15-year product warranty backed by a 30-year performance term.

How this is modelled

Compounds this panel’s own published first-year (1%) and annual (0.35%/yr) degradation figures against its 495 W rated (STC) output, then derates for the ambient and irradiance selected. Output is scaled roughly linearly with irradiance (1000W/m² against the 1000 W/m² STC reference). This is the dominant real-world effect at low light, whether from cloud, shading or soiling. Output is then further derated for heat, from this panel’s own NOCT (45°C) and temperature coefficient (-0.26%/°C), giving an estimated cell temperature of 61°C at that ambient and irradiance. A datasheet-derived estimate, not a field measurement or a warranty guarantee: it does not account for this panel’s own low-light efficiency response (a separate, less-consistently-published spec), or for wind and system design.
